Benitez tells Chelsea fans: I have previous in reviving teams

Rafa Benitez says he knows how to revive Chelsea's fortunes this season.

Benitez rejuvenated underdogs Valencia eight years ago when up against mighty Real Madrid.

He said: "When I was at Valencia we were seven or eight points behind in January. I was talking with Ayala, Canizares and Pellegrino and told them we would win the league.

"They thought I was crazy. But the way that we trained was key. And the way we train here is, too. I have confidence we will be better and better every single week."

A fixture pile-up is the biggest problem to Benitez's immediate plans.

He said: "The difficulty is that we come back on Monday and have to play Leeds on Wednesday, so we'll have to change quickly.

"Yesterday I was preparing the squad for Leeds.

"I have an idea of that squad but I cannot lose my focus - Monterrey was first and now it's Corinthians."
